# Break-Glass: Cartwheel Parcel Webhook

New folks: if the Cartwheel parcel-tracking webhook jams and retries pile up, use break-glass replay. Drain the dead-letter queue first. Then trigger manual replay from the ops console — sparingly. Replay mode is gated and asks for the emergency passphrase, written just below.

strongbox words: fenwyn-tamys-norys-lamius-gilion-gilath

Handover: MatchPoint service. We've been seeing GC pauses up to 400ms during peak matching windows, which trips the latency alarm. I tuned the heap regions last sprint and it helped, but the root cause is the order-book snapshot allocation churn. Tomas has context on the snapshot rewrite. The full pause-analysis notes and heap dumps live on the internal wiki page below.

operations page: https://jenkins.zemvarcloud.local/job/merge_requests/repo/build/73930b4b30f0a8ed

**Handover: Ledgerbeam billing worker, blue-green deploys**

For plugin authors: deploys alternate between two pools; only one drains billing jobs at a time. Your plugin must tolerate a mid-job pool switch — checkpoint often. Cutover is automatic once health checks pass. Don't hardcode pool names. Both pools load the same worker configuration, reproduced in full below.

config for haweg-bagag:
[kasath]
host = kasath.qirvancorp.internal
user = kasath_svc
database = kasath_prod

/*
 * Digest scheduling for Mailwhistle: we batch per-user digests into
 * windows so the Corvid queue doesn't get slammed at the top of the
 * hour. Reviewers: the jitter here is deliberate — removing it brings
 * back the thundering herd. The knobs that control all this are the
 * following.
 */

tuning constants:
QUOTAS = {
    "druwyn": 5,
    "holix": 5,
    "zorath": 5,
    "holwyn": 10,
}

# Retention Sweeper — release config (Tidewell platform)
# Reviewed each release by the release manager before promotion.
# The sweeper walks cold-storage partitions nightly and purges rows
# past their tenant-defined retention window. Dry-run mode must stay
# enabled until the promotion checklist is signed off. Do not copy
# this file between environments; each one carries its own purge
# authorization. The sweeper's storage credential belongs on the
# very next line.

secret setting of bajeg-bafop: ARCHIVE_KEY3=3e7